    I am new to Surfcam!

    How I can be machined letters surfcam?

    Create your text, practice with different fonts and sizes, truetype font is best.

    When you have what you think is good, go to EDIT/TEXT/EXPLODE select [within] and box in your text, then click [DONE]....

    That will turn your text into ordinary, line/circle/spline geometry, fix it up if you have to make it continuous and connected and you can machine it, probably using the pocket command......

    I do it as Billetgrip has outlined above. Under 2 Axis options I set the Maximum feed between to 0.0000, the sort type to "None", and the gouge check to "Single". After exploding the text like machinster explained I then use NC/ 2 Axis/ Contour. Set the mask to the color of the previously exploded letters, then use Auto to let the program select the geometry. No need to fix up any non-connected entities. Each time a chain gap exceeds or overlaps a certain amount the program ask you to "end" or cancel, just hit "end" and it will continue until it selects all that you need cut. I save this tool path in the template as "Lettering". This has worked for about 20 years on just about every type of font I've tried.
